Understanding Material Option



When it involves storage tank manufacturing, the choice of suitable materials is critical to ensuring sturdiness, safety, and compliance with industry requirements. The products picked should withstand various environmental problems, consisting of temperature level fluctuations, destructive substances, and physical stressors. Typical materials include carbon steel, stainless-steel, and numerous types of polymers, each offering unique advantages and negative aspects depending upon the application.


Carbon steel is preferred for its toughness and cost-effectiveness, making it suitable for a vast variety of applications. It is prone to rust, requiring safety finishes or cathodic security systems. Stainless steel, while more costly, uses remarkable resistance to corrosion and is ideal for keeping hostile chemicals. Careful factor to consider of the certain quality is crucial to ensure compatibility with the kept substances.


Along with rust resistance, elements such as tensile strength, thermal conductivity, and convenience of fabrication have to be reviewed. Compliance with regulative requirements, such as those established by the American Petroleum Institute (API) or the American Society for Screening and Products (ASTM), is additionally paramount. Eventually, a thorough understanding of material residential properties and their communications with saved components is crucial for the reliable and risk-free procedure of storage space containers.

Performing Regular Inspections



While the manufacturing procedure develops a foundation for storage tank honesty, conducting routine evaluations is essential for ensuring recurring compliance with safety and security and efficiency criteria. These examinations offer to recognize potential problems that may develop with time, such as deterioration, leaks, and structural weak points. By implementing a routine inspection schedule, suppliers can proactively resolve these issues prior to they escalate into even more substantial troubles.


Regular assessments ought to incorporate both aesthetic evaluations and in-depth analyses making use of advanced innovations, such as ultrasonic screening or radiography. This diverse technique enables a comprehensive evaluation of the tank's problem and helps in validating that all parts remain within regulatory conformity. Paperwork of assessment searchings for is critical, as it gives a historic document that can assist in pattern analysis and future decision-making.




Involving trained professionals for evaluations guarantees that experienced eyes are looking at the tanks. Their expertise can lead to the recognition of refined problems that may go undetected by inexperienced personnel. Ultimately, normal assessments are a necessary element of storage tank upkeep, contributing notably to the longevity and reliability of the containers, while protecting compliance with market requirements.
